Interinactive wrote:


I know they have 3D assets for sniper cases, so hopefully that's wrong


From the Q&A near the end of the vid:

Quote:
The suitcase is not a part of Hitman: Absolution. It's not to say it's not a part of the franchise any more, t's just that we really wanted to create a more improvised, more "movie feeling" instalment if you will, because at the heart of it 47 doesn't really know what happened, he's starting to question a lot of things, and he needs to figure out quite desperately who's this girl that he's charged to protect by Diana, who you'll know if you know the franchise. So we felt that it would fit the nature of the game better. Much of the time he's in the environments that he didn't pre-plan, and that he doesn't know that well, whereas in the old games you really got down to the detailed descriptions of the hits you were going to perform.
